French submarine 'Saphir' (Q44) and five others moving from Gravesend to London, July 1909 Finish:20-pack Yosemite FallsFrench submarine 'Saphir' (Q44) and five others moving from Gravesend to London, July 1909. A submarine of the 'Emeraude' class, the 'Saphir' was launched in 1908. She was sunk on 15 January 1915 when she struck a mine in the Dardanelles. A print from L'Illustration, 24 July 1909.
